diff options
Diffstat (limited to 'Lib/idlelib/run.py')
-rw-r--r-- | Lib/idlelib/run.py | 12 |
1 files changed, 7 insertions, 5 deletions
diff --git a/Lib/idlelib/run.py b/Lib/idlelib/run.py index 4075deec51..6b3928b7bf 100644 --- a/Lib/idlelib/run.py +++ b/Lib/idlelib/run.py @@ -199,11 +199,13 @@ def show_socket_error(err, address): root = tkinter.Tk() fix_scaling(root) root.withdraw() - msg = f"IDLE's subprocess can't connect to {address[0]}:{address[1]}.\n"\ - f"Fatal OSError #{err.errno}: {err.strerror}.\n"\ - f"See the 'Startup failure' section of the IDLE doc, online at\n"\ - f"https://docs.python.org/3/library/idle.html#startup-failure" - showerror("IDLE Subprocess Error", msg, parent=root) + showerror( + "Subprocess Connection Error", + f"IDLE's subprocess can't connect to {address[0]}:{address[1]}.\n" + f"Fatal OSError #{err.errno}: {err.strerror}.\n" + "See the 'Startup failure' section of the IDLE doc, online at\n" + "https://docs.python.org/3/library/idle.html#startup-failure", + parent=root) root.destroy() def print_exception(): |